Indiana Code 8-1-13-5. Articles of incorporation; action by commission
(b) If the commission approves the articles of incorporation under subsection (a), the same shall be filed together with the attached copy of the order of the commission in the office of the secretary of state. The secretary of state shall forthwith endorse the secretary of state’s approval on the articles of incorporation and file one (1) of said copies in the secretary of state’s office and deliver all other copies endorsed with the secretary of state’s approval to the incorporators, who shall thereupon file one (1) of the said approved copies of said articles in the office of the county recorder in each county in which a portion of the territory proposed to be served by the corporation is located. As soon as this section has been complied with, the proposed corporation described in the articles so filed, under its designated name, shall be and constitute a body corporate.
Formerly: Acts 1935, c.175, s.5. As amended by P.L.23-1988, SEC.47; P.L.136-2018, SEC.67.
